Olam a star
Justin Olam (and his Melbourne Storm team) may have missed out on the record 20th consecutive NRL win but he remains the favourite to win the 2021 Dally M award for best center. A big feat indeed.
Bus stop
Maybe City Hall is not aware that the men it assigned to keep the bus stops clean around the city have been demanding cash from those wanting to sit there to wait for buses. It’s so unfair. Since when does one have to pay to use a bus stop?

Top quote
“The people of PNG do not need to know the details of the (Marape-led government) plans. The people only need the outcomes of plans delivered. We are seeing too much of plans been launched by this prime minister and too little of the plans actually bearing tangible results.” – Opposition Leader Belden Namah.
